Download Embedded Controller Hardware Design by Ken Arnold PDF

By Ken Arnold

Ken Arnold is an skilled embedded structures dressmaker and president of HiTech apparatus, Inc., an embedded platforms layout enterprise positioned in San Diego, California. He additionally teaches classes in embedded and software program layout on the college of California-San Diego.

Gives the reader an built-in hardware/software method of embedded controller design
Stresses a "worst case" layout procedure for the tough environments within which embedded structures are frequently used
Includes layout examples to make vital ideas come alive

Show description

Read or Download Embedded Controller Hardware Design PDF

Similar microelectronics books

Electroceramic-based MEMS: fabrication-technology and applications

The e-book is concentrated at the use of useful oxide and nitride skinny movies to extend performance and alertness diversity of MEMS (microelectromechanical platforms) within the huge feel, together with micro-sensors, micro-actuators, and digital parts for prime frequency communications. The publication covers significant issues and is split into components (a) functions and rising functions, and (b) fabrics, fabrication applied sciences, and functioning concerns.

Inkjet-Based Micromanufacturing

Inkjet-based Micromanufacturing Inkjet know-how is going method past placing ink on paper: it permits less complicated, quicker and extra trustworthy production procedures within the fields of micro- and nanotechnology. smooth inkjet heads are according to se precision tools that deposit droplets of fluids on a number of surfaces in programmable, repeating styles, permitting, after compatible adjustments and variations, the producing of units reminiscent of thin-film transistors, polymer-based monitors and photovoltaic components.

STAMP 2 Communications and Control Projects

By way of including strength to advanced digital circuits, the fundamental STAMP II microprocessor is the traditional opposed to which all others are judged. And now, due to STAMP II Communications and regulate tasks, studying how one can combine this flexible expertise along with your subsequent venture is less complicated than ever.

Organic Thin-Film Transistor Applications: Materials to Circuits

D104 presents information regarding complicated OTFT (Organic skinny movie transistor) constructions, their modeling and extraction of functionality parameters, fabrics of person layers, their molecular constructions, fundamentals of pi-conjugated semiconducting fabrics and their houses, OTFT cost shipping phenomena and fabrication suggestions.

Extra info for Embedded Controller Hardware Design

Example text

Not all SFRs are bit addressable, and not all bit addresses are used in most processors. Bit Number Internal Data Memory 7F 30 2F Bit Addressable 20 1F 00 Figure 2-11: Bit addressable space in the internal data memory. Byte Addr 7 6 5 4 3 2 1 0 2F 2E 2D 2C 2B 2A 29 28 27 26 25 24 23 21 22 20 7F 77 6F 67 5F 57 4F 47 3F 37 2F 27 1F 17 0F 07 7E 76 6E 66 5E 56 4E 46 3E 36 2E 26 1E 16 0E 06 7D 75 6D 65 5D 55 4D 45 3D 35 2D 25 1D 15 0D 05 7C 74 6C 64 5C 54 4C 44 3C 34 2C 24 1C 14 0C 04 7B 73 6B 63 5B 53 4B 43 3B 33 2B 23 1B 13 0B 03 7A 72 6A 62 5A 52 4A 42 3A 32 2A 22 1A 12 0A 02 79 71 69 61 59 51 49 41 39 31 29 21 19 11 09 01 78 70 68 60 58 50 48 40 38 30 28 20 18 10 08 00 MOV C<->bit# CLR bit# SETB bit# CPL bit# JB bit#, addr JNB bit#, addr Bit addressable memory allows the manipulation and test of individual bits, which is a very common operation in embedded systems.

The 8031 contains Memory FFFF Figure 2-9: Data memory 128 bytes of internal data address spaces in the 8051. RAM and 20 special function registers (SFRs), while most External Data other processor family variants Internal Special Memory Data Function include an additional 128 bytes Memory Registers /RD or See below See separate address map of internal data memory over/WR Pulse FF FF lapped with the SFR addresses. Low MOV @R0/1 MOV 80-FF 80 7F 80 MOV 00-7F Data Memory 00 Some SFRs are also bit addressable MOVX a 0000 The 8051 family devices have two data memories, internal and external.

The purpose for using tri-state logic is to allow multiple devices to share wires by taking turns one at a time. This may sound a bit silly, but it is just one form of multiplexing, or sharing a resource that needs to be allocated among multiple devices. When the resource is a collection of parallel data wires, referred to as a data bus, and the bus is shared by multiple microcomputer CPU and peripheral devices transferring information one at a time in sequence, it is referred to as a multiplexed data bus.

Download PDF sample

Rated 4.41 of 5 – based on 16 votes